[发明专利]流媒体的频道切换方法、切换代理、客户端及终端无效
申请号: | 201010249990.4 | 申请日: | 2010-08-10 |
公开(公告)号: | CN102143132A | 公开(公告)日: | 2011-08-03 |
发明(设计)人: | 夏斌 | 申请(专利权)人: | 华为技术有限公司 |
主分类号: | H04L29/06 | 分类号: | H04L29/06;H04N21/236 |
代理公司: | 北京凯特来知识产权代理有限公司 11260 | 代理人: | 郑立明;孟丽娟 |
地址: | 518129 广东*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 流媒体 频道 切换 方法 代理 客户端 终端 | ||
技术领域
本发明涉及通信技术领域,尤其涉及一种流媒体的频道切换方法、频道切换代理、流媒体客户端及终端。
背景技术
流媒体是指:采用流式传输方式的媒体格式。具体的,3GPP R7规范中定义了流媒体的快速频道切换(Fast Channel Switching,FCS)方案:在流媒体直播业务中,终端和流媒体服务器之间在不重新拆建媒体播放会话的前提下完成频道切换处理,从而减少频道切换过程的用户操作,提升用户体验。
在实现本发明过程中,发明人发现现有技术中至少存在如下问题:
由于3GPP R7规范的快速频道切换方案要求客户端的播放模块具备支持快速频道切换能力,客户端指可以在终端中运行的软件或模块,而当前较多的播放模块都没有开放快速频道切换的接口,导致该快速频道切换方案限于播放模块的能力,可应用的终端不广泛。而且,该快速频道切换方案基于客户端的播放模块和流媒体服务器之间的RTSP(Real Time Streaming Protocol,实时流传输协议)协商交互,导致影响当前流媒体播放。
发明内容
本发明的实施例提供了一种流媒体的频道切换方法、频道切换代理、流媒体客户端及终端,通过流媒体客户端的业务模块实现频道切换。
本发明的实施例提供一种流媒体的频道切换方法,包括:
流媒体客户端的播放模块播放当前频道的流媒体数据;
当频道切换代理接收到所述流媒体客户端的业务模块发送的频道切换请求消息后,所述频道切换代理将所述频道切换请求消息发送给流媒体服务器,所述频道切换请求消息携带切换后的频道标识信息以及所述流媒体客户端的客户端标识信息;
所述流媒体服务器通过所述客户端标识对应的流媒体播放会话,发送所述切换后的频道标识对应的流媒体数据给所述流媒体客户端的播放模块,由所述播放模块播放所述切换后的频道标识对应的流媒体数据。
本发明的实施例还提供一种流媒体的频道切换方法,包括:
流媒体客户端的播放模块播放当前频道的流媒体数据;
所述流媒体客户端的业务模块发送频道切换请求消息给频道切换代理,所述频道切换请求消息携带切换后的频道标识信息以及所述流媒体客户端的客户端标识信息;
所述流媒体客户端的播放模块接收流媒体服务器通过所述客户端标识对应的流媒体播放会话发送的所述切换后的频道标识对应的流媒体数据,所述播放模块播放所述切换后的频道标识对应的流媒体数据。
对应的,本发明的实施例提供一种流媒体客户端,包括:
业务模块,用于播放模块播放当前频道的流媒体数据时,向频道切换代理发送频道切换请求消息,所述频道切换请求消息携带切换后的频道标识信息以及所述流媒体客户端的客户端标识信息;
播放模块,用于播放当前频道的流媒体数据,并在频道切换后,通过所述客户端标识对应的流媒体播放会话接收流媒体服务器发送的所述切换后的频道标识对应的流媒体数据,并播放所述流媒体服务器发送的所述切换后的频道标识对应的流媒体数据。
本发明的实施例还提供一种终端,包括上述的流媒体客户端。
对应的,本发明的实施例还提供一种频道切换代理,包括:
接收单元,用于接收流媒体客户端的业务模块发送的频道切换请求消息,所述频道切换请求消息携带切换后的频道标识信息以及所述流媒体客户端的客户端标识信息;
发送单元,用于将携带所述切换后的频道标识信息及所述客户端标识信息的频道切换请求消息发送给流媒体服务器。
由上述本发明的实施例提供的技术方案可以看出,流媒体客户端的业务模块与流媒体服务器配合实现频道切换,对流媒体客户端的播放模块的播放能力不作限制,可应用的终端广泛,而且,频道切换不依赖终端和流媒体服务器之间的实时流媒体协商,不会影响当前流媒体播放。
附图说明
为了更清楚地说明本发明实施例的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。
图1为本发明一实施例流媒体的频道切换方法的流程示意图;
图2为本发明另一实施例流媒体的频道切换方法的流程示意图;
图3为本发明一实施例流媒体客户端的构成示意图;
图4为本发明一实施例终端的构成示意图;
图5为本发明一实施例频道切换代理的构成示意图;
图6为本发明一实施例流媒体的频道切换系统的构成示意图;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于华为技术有限公司,未经华为技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201010249990.4/2.html,转载请声明来源钻瓜专利网。